A Study on Pattern Analysis of Odorous Substances with a Single Gas Sensor

Abstract: This study used a single metal oxide semiconductor (MOS) sensor to classify the major odorous gases hydrogen sulfide (H 2 S), ammonia (NH 3 ) and toluene (C 6 H 5 CH 3 ). In order to classify these odorous substances, the voltage on the MOS sensor heater was gradually reduced in 0.5 V steps 5.0 V to examine the changes to the response by the cooling effect on the sensor as the voltage decreased.
